Tesla Idles China Plant, Suspending Vehicle Output Worldwide

  • Company says it’s conducting normal maintenance work
  • Workers at Shanghai factory told to return as soon as May 9

Tesla Inc. suspended production at its plant on the outskirts of Shanghai, according to people familiar with the matter, bringing to a halt all of the company’s vehicle manufacturing globally.

The electric-car maker informed factory workers who were supposed to return to work Wednesday, after China’s five-day Labor Day break, that their holiday would be extended and they will return as soon as May 9, according to the the people, who asked not to be identified because the information isn’t public.
